Authorities in Australia have arrested two men believed to be members of TeamPCP, a prolific cybercrime and data extortion group blamed for perpetrating the longest running spree of software supply chain attacks ever. In a statement released today, the Australian Federal Police (AFP) said two unnamed suspects from Western Australia, aged 21 and 23, were arrested in connection with a “sophisticated cybercrime syndicate that allegedly created malicious open-source software to rob thousands of global businesses.” The AFP did not name…

In early January 2026, KrebsOnSecurity revealed how a security researcher disclosed a vulnerability that was used to assemble Kimwolf, the world’s largest and most disruptive botnet. Since then, the person in control of Kimwolf — who goes by the handle “Dort” — has coordinated a barrage of distributed denial-of-service (DDoS), doxing and email flooding attacks against the researcher and this author, and more recently caused a SWAT team to be sent to the researcher’s home.
